Introduction to Tree Surgeons in Bramhall

Tree surgeons, often known as arborists, play a crucial role in maintaining the health and aesthetics of trees. In Bramhall, a picturesque suburb in Greater Manchester, these professionals are in high demand due to the area's lush greenery and mature trees. This article delves into the world of tree surgeons in Bramhall, exploring their responsibilities, the importance of their work, and how they contribute to the community's well-being.

What Does a Tree Surgeon Do?

Tree surgeons are skilled professionals who specialise in the care and maintenance of trees. Their tasks range from pruning and trimming to removing dead or hazardous trees. They also diagnose tree diseases and pests, offering solutions to preserve tree health. In Bramhall, where trees are an integral part of the landscape, tree surgeons ensure that these natural assets remain safe and beautiful.

The Importance of Tree Maintenance

Regular tree maintenance is vital for several reasons. It helps prevent potential hazards, such as falling branches, which can cause property damage or personal injury. Moreover, well-maintained trees enhance the aesthetic appeal of an area, increasing property values and contributing to the overall quality of life. In Bramhall, tree surgeons play a key role in maintaining the suburb's charm and safety.

Tools and Techniques Used by Tree Surgeons

Tree surgeons employ a variety of tools and techniques to perform their duties effectively. Chainsaws, pruning shears, and climbing equipment are commonly used to access and manage tree canopies. Advanced techniques, such as crown thinning and deadwood removal, are employed to ensure tree health and safety. In Bramhall, tree surgeons are equipped with the latest tools to handle any tree-related challenge.

Qualifications and Training for Tree Surgeons

Becoming a tree surgeon requires a combination of formal education and hands-on experience. Many tree surgeons in Bramhall hold qualifications in arboriculture or forestry, which provide a solid foundation in tree biology and care. Additionally, practical training and apprenticeships are essential for developing the skills needed to perform complex tree surgery tasks safely and efficiently.

Certifications and Professional Associations

Tree surgeons often pursue certifications from recognised bodies, such as the Arboricultural Association, to demonstrate their expertise and commitment to professional standards. Membership in professional associations provides access to ongoing education and networking opportunities, ensuring that tree surgeons in Bramhall stay current with industry developments and best practices.

Common Tree Diseases and Pests in Bramhall

Trees in Bramhall are susceptible to various diseases and pests, which can compromise their health and safety. Common issues include fungal infections, such as ash dieback, and insect infestations, like the oak processionary moth. Tree surgeons are trained to identify these problems early and implement effective treatment plans to protect Bramhall's trees.

Preventative Measures and Treatments

Preventative measures, such as regular inspections and proper tree care, are crucial in managing tree diseases and pests. Tree surgeons in Bramhall use a combination of chemical treatments, biological controls, and cultural practices to prevent and treat infestations. By staying vigilant, they help ensure the longevity and vitality of the area's trees.

Choosing the Right Tree Surgeon in Bramhall

Selecting a qualified and experienced tree surgeon is essential for ensuring quality tree care. When choosing a tree surgeon in Bramhall, consider factors such as qualifications, experience, and customer reviews. It's also important to verify that the tree surgeon is insured and adheres to industry safety standards.

Questions to Ask a Prospective Tree Surgeon

  • What qualifications and certifications do you hold?
  • Can you provide references from previous clients?
  • What safety measures do you implement during tree surgery?
  • How do you handle waste disposal and environmental impact?
  • What is your approach to managing tree diseases and pests?

The Cost of Tree Surgery in Bramhall

The cost of tree surgery can vary widely depending on the complexity of the job, the size of the tree, and the specific services required. In Bramhall, tree surgeons typically offer competitive pricing, with transparent quotes provided before work begins. It's important to obtain multiple quotes to ensure you're receiving fair value for the services rendered.

Factors Influencing Tree Surgery Costs

Several factors can influence the cost of tree surgery, including:

  • The height and accessibility of the tree
  • The type of work required (e.g., pruning, removal, disease treatment)
  • The urgency of the job
  • Disposal of tree waste
  • Additional services, such as stump grinding or site cleanup

Safety Considerations in Tree Surgery

Tree surgery is a hazardous profession, requiring strict adherence to safety protocols to protect both the tree surgeon and the public. In Bramhall, tree surgeons prioritise safety by using appropriate personal protective equipment, conducting thorough risk assessments, and following industry guidelines.

Common Safety Practices

  • Wearing helmets, gloves, and eye protection
  • Using harnesses and ropes for climbing
  • Ensuring equipment is well-maintained and regularly inspected
  • Establishing clear communication among team members
  • Implementing traffic and pedestrian control measures when working near roads

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the difference between a tree surgeon and an arborist? Tree surgeons and arborists are essentially the same, both specialising in tree care and maintenance.
  • How often should trees be inspected by a tree surgeon? It's recommended to have trees inspected annually, or more frequently if there are signs of disease or damage.
  • Can tree surgery be performed year-round? Yes, tree surgery can be performed year-round, though certain tasks may be best suited to specific seasons.
  • Do tree surgeons offer emergency services? Many tree surgeons in Bramhall offer emergency services for urgent situations, such as storm damage.
  • How can I tell if a tree is diseased? Signs of a diseased tree include discoloured leaves, dead branches, and fungal growth on the trunk.
  • What should I do if I suspect a tree is a hazard? Contact a qualified tree surgeon immediately to assess the situation and recommend appropriate action.
